What is a QSP Quantitative professional?

A QSP Quantitative professional specializes in Quantitative Systems Pharmacology (QSP), which combines mathematical modeling and computational techniques to understand and predict how drugs interact with biological systems. They use quantitative analysis to inform drug discovery, development, and regulatory decisions. QSP Quantitative experts often work in pharmaceutical companies or research institutions, collaborating with biologists, clinicians, and other scientists to optimize drug efficacy and safety. Their work helps translate complex biological data into actionable insights, improving the efficiency and success rate of drug development.

How does a QSP Quantitative professional typically collaborate with cross-functional teams in pharmaceutical development?

QSP Quantitative professionals often work closely with pharmacologists, clinicians, statisticians, and regulatory teams to develop and refine quantitative models that inform drug development decisions. Collaboration usually involves translating complex biological data into actionable insights, presenting model outcomes, and adapting models based on feedback from other disciplines. Open communication and a willingness to explain technical details to non-experts are key to ensuring that quantitative models effectively support project goals throughout different drug development stages.

What are the key skills and qualifications needed to thrive as a QSP Quantitative scientist, and why are they important?

To thrive as a QSP Quantitative Scientist, you need a solid background in pharmacometrics, mathematical modeling, and systems pharmacology, often supported by an advanced degree in pharmacology, mathematics, or a related field. Familiarity with modeling software such as MATLAB, NONMEM, or SimBiology, and experience with programming languages like R or Python, are typically required. Strong analytical thinking, problem-solving abilities, and clear communication skills help translate complex data into actionable insights for multidisciplinary teams. These skills are crucial for accurately predicting drug behavior, optimizing clinical trial designs, and supporting data-driven decision-making in pharmaceutical development.

Overview
The Quantitative Systems Pharmacology (QSP) Lead is responsible for establishing and operationalizing QSP to support development decisions in rare disease programs. This role serves as the scientific and strategic owner of QSP across high-priority programs, with responsibility for both building an end-to-end QSP operating model and delivering modeling outputs that inform clinical and development strategy.
The incumbent will design and implement the full QSP workflow-from intake and prioritization through model development, technical review, and integration into development decisions-while ensuring outputs are reproducible, reviewable, and aligned with program needs. The role requires a balance of hands-on modeling and scientific oversight, including the effective use and management of external modeling partners, while retaining full ownership of modeling strategy and outputs.
This position operates in a highly matrixed environment and partners closely with cross-functional stakeholders to translate quantitative insights into actionable development decisions. The role is focused on high-impact rare disease programs, particularly those requiring integration across biomarkers, disease progression, and regulatory considerations, and is expected to define a roadmap for scaling QSP capabilities over time.
